CSI SAP2000
SAP2000 provides you with a versatile environment for the modeling, analysis, and design of any type of structural system. Whether you are working on simple 2D frames or complex 3D geometries, you can create models using powerful templates and a graphical user interface that simplifies the engineering process. It handles everything from basic static analysis to advanced dynamic non-linear applications, making it a standard tool for professionals in the transportation, industrial, and public works sectors.
You can perform integrated design for steel, concrete, and aluminum structures within a single interface. The software automates complex calculations for wind, wave, and seismic loads, ensuring your projects meet international building codes. It is designed for structural engineers who need a reliable, all-in-one solution that scales from small residential tasks to massive infrastructure projects like bridges and stadiums.

CSI SAP2000 Features
- Object-Based Modeling. Create complex structural models quickly using a familiar graphical interface and built-in templates for common structures.
- Advanced Analysis Engine. Run linear and non-linear analyses, including time-history and buckling, to understand how your structure behaves under stress.
- Automated Loading. Generate wind, seismic, and wave loads automatically based on various international codes to save hours of manual calculation.
- Integrated Design. Check and optimize steel, concrete, and aluminum members against global design standards directly within your model.
- Interactive Database Editing. Edit your model data in a spreadsheet-like format to make bulk changes and manage large datasets efficiently.
- Section Designer. Define custom cross-sections for your structural members and calculate their properties automatically for precise analysis.
